The Over-Enthusiastic Maintenance Technician: A maintenance technician, eager to demonstrate his diligence, lubricated a bearing so excessively that it leaked grease throughout the machine. The lesson: Lubricate moderately as per the manufacturer's guidelines.
The Misaligned Shaft: A mechanic installed a flanged bearing on a shaft without paying attention to alignment. As a result, the bearing wore out prematurely. The lesson: Ensure proper shaft alignment before mounting the bearing.
The Wrong Bearing for the Job: A company ordered flanged bearings for a high-load application, but accidentally received radial bearings instead of thrust bearings. The bearings failed after a short period of use. The lesson: Always confirm the correct bearing type before installing.
